Yesterday I set off from Drežniške Ravne over planina Golobar towards Lipnik. In beautiful weather I climbed only to the saddle between Lipnik and some unnamed point; there is snow on the last hundred meters to the saddle. From the saddle to the Lipnik summit it's only a couple of dozen elevation meters, but the approach is too exposed in these snowy conditions for my climbing abilities. A well-maintained mulatjera leads below this saddle; given that the path isn't marked, it's somewhat ruined just below the saddle. Full praise to whoever maintains the path and eases our approach.

(Veliki) Lipnik is in the background, a bit off the main ridge direction. From the saddle the path descends a bit (quickly in better condition than the last meters of ascent to the saddle), there again visible military remains and pitons from former cables. But there are at least three more approaches.  On Srednja Špica there was a nest on the last visit, so better not go there. By the way, down here was the epicenter of the last Tolmin earthquake.
